



Home Care Aides play a vital role in supporting individuals with daily living activities. The average yearly salary for a Home Care Aide is about $40,727. This reflects the important services they provide to their clients and communities.
Looking at the salary range, it varies significantly based on experience and location. At the starting level, Home Care Aides earn around $23,200 per year. With more experience, salaries can rise to approximately $30,182, $37,164, or even higher. The upper range allows seasoned professionals to earn up to $100,000 annually. This variation highlights the potential growth in this field.
Most Home Care Aides fall within the $23,200 to $58,109 salary bracket, with many enjoying steady career advancement as they gain experience and skills. As a Home Care Aide, you can take steps to increase your earnings. Focus on these key factors:
- Increase Your Qualifications: Consider pursuing additional certifications in areas like CPR, first aid, or specialized care for conditions like dementia. More training can lead to higher pay.
- Gain Experience: Build a strong resume by accumulating experience in various settings. More years in the field often mean higher wages.
- Work for Reputable Agencies: Choose well-established home care agencies. These organizations may offer better pay and benefits compared to smaller or less-known companies.
- Offer Specialized Services: Develop skills in specialized areas, such as palliative care or physical therapy. Clients often pay more for aides with specific skill sets.
- Network with Other Professionals: Connect with others in the field. Networking can lead to job referrals and opportunities for higher-paying positions.
By focusing on these factors, you can enhance your skills and increase your earning potential as a Home Care Aide.
